Product Description:
The AKM32C-ACCNR-00 is a Kollmorgen servo motor in the AKM Synchronous Servo Motors series. It is intended for high-cycle industrial automation axes where compact torque and precise velocity loops are needed. Its mechanical envelope stays compact for machines that need controlled motion without taking up additional installation space. This makes the unit suitable for densely packed axis layouts such as small indexing stations, transfer modules, and other equipment that depends on repeatable motion.
The motor is supplied without a brake, so an external device or drive-held torque is required to keep a load in position after power is removed. Field wiring is handled through 2 SpeedTec Ready connectors that accept keyed quick-lock plugs and support straightforward cable attachment. Commutation and position feedback come from a Resolver with a 2-pole feedback resolution, which provides rugged electrical angle feedback for servo control. The motor uses a 70 mm square flange to keep the mounting face consistent with other AKM motors in the same size class. Resolver hardware follows the Size 10/15/21 format, which matches compatible drive inputs and supports stable signal interpretation in demanding industrial service.
The rotor position device is single-turn inductive, so feedback is limited to one electrical revolution and does not use multiturn memory. The front face follows the IEC with accuracy N flange pattern, which supports accurate installation on metric gearbox and machine interfaces. Output torque is transmitted through a shaft with a keyway, and the stator uses winding designation C, which sets the motor's voltage constant for the matched drive. Rotor length index 2 indicates the stack depth used in this housing, and the standard build means the motor is supplied without custom machining beyond the normal production form.
